The Influence of Road Congestion on Urban Mobility
Author(s): Gheorghe Neamtu, Marinela Inta, Ioan Tincu

Abstract:
Urban mobility is defined by all the travel possibilities within a city and their spatial arrangement. In recent times, the world's major cities are changing their infrastructure to accommodate alternative and public transport modes and are also developing car-free policies as they increase mobility and pursue a sustainable future. Congestion in road traffic is defined as the phenomenon of the reduction of vehicle flow speed to the point of zero due to so-called sensitive areas on the road. This scientific paper has been developed by the authors in a logical and elegant manner, which deals with the influence of road vehicle traffic congestion on urban mobility in cities in the European Union. In this way, those interested can get acquainted with the main factors and conditions favoring the occurrence of road traffic congestion, the deterioration of urban mobility due to road traffic congestion in the European Union and the queues of road vehicles (moving or stationary columns at intersections, pedestrian crossings, railway level crossings, accidents or road events, etc.). The scientific paper also deals with two case studies on waiting wires. At the end the conclusions related to this research area are drawn and some recommendations are made by the authors regarding the field. The paper also contains an annex in which the 30-minute accessibility by car during peak hours in 2012 and 2019 in other EU cities is presented.
